What Students Meet

Five myths with clear classroom hooks.

  • Pangu separates sky and earth.
  • Nuwa mends the broken sky.
  • Hou Yi restores balance when ten suns rise.
  • Jingwei keeps going when the task feels impossible.
  • Shennong studies plants to help people live better.
